A Non-Singular Universe in String Cosmology
A. A. Al-Nowaiser🇸🇦 · Murat Özer🇸🇦 · M. O. Taha🇸🇦
Abstract
We consider the low-energy effective string action in four dimensions including the leading order- terms. An exact homogeneous solution is obtained. It represents a non-singular expanding cosmological model in which the tensor fields tend to vanish as . The scale factor of the very early universe in this model has the time dependence . The violation of the strong energy condition of classical General Relativity to avoid the initial singularity requires that the central charge deficit of the theory be larger than a certain value. The significance of this solution is discussed.
